#e6ae1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6ae1e is composed of 90.2% red, 68.2%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 87%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 43.2 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 51%. #e6ae1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3c with #cd5d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#e6ae1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6ae1e has RGB values of R:230, G:174,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.87,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15117854.

Shades and Tints of #e6ae1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fefaf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6ae1e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86847e is the less saturated color, while #f9b60b is the most saturated one.
